This date will help you find out when you should apply for the H1B visa stamping. The rule is that you should apply around 90 days before you have to begin working in the US. This means that if your employment starting date is on August 1 st, you can apply for the visa in the beginning of May.

Why is US visa stamping delayed?

Visa processing delays can occur where the consular official at the visa interview determines that further screening is necessary before the visa can be issued. The consular officer will indicate that the application must undergo administrative processing.

What can cause visa delay?

Delays are usually caused by additional security and background clearances due to your citizenship, ties to specific countries, or field of study. These additional clearance checks may take several weeks to several months to process. There is no way to circumvent or expedite this process.

Why are visas taking so long?

We've established that visa wait times grow because there is a statutory limit on the number of green cards the government may issue each year. But there's more. In addition to that, U.S. immigration law says no more than seven percent of all immigrant visas can be given to people of one country in a given year.

How to request an expedited appointment?

How to Request an Expedited Appointment: Applicants can request an expedited appointment through our online appointment system at https://www.ustraveldocs.com/in/expedited-appointment.html. You must already have a confirmed interview appointment date in order to request an expedited appointment. If your expedited appointment request is approved, you will be notified with instructions via email. You should not cancel your existing appointment unless you receive a confirmation that your request for an expedited appointment has been approved. If you have not yet received an approval or denial, your request is still under consideration.

Is there a drop box for visa renewal in India?

Drop Box Appointments: Consular sections across India are now accepting a limited number of drop box applications for renewals of H, L, C1/D, O, I, F, M, and J visas at our Visa Application Centers. Please visit our website to determine whether you are eligible for drop box processing and schedule an appointment for document drop-off. A list of drop-off locations is available on our website.

What is Section 214 B?

Section 214 (b) of the INA requires all applicants to overcome the presumption of immigrant intent by establishing that they have sufficient professional, economic, and social ties to assure their departure after a limited stay in the United States & their intent to abide by the terms of the visa class.

What is non-immigrant visa?

Non-immigrant visas are interview-based. Interviewing officers rely on statements made by the applicant to determine visa eligibility, although they may consult supporting documents such as affidavits of support, travel arrangements, employment letters or financial statements to verify statements made in the interview.

What if I returned with I-94?

If you returned home with your departure record Form I-94 (white) or Form I-94W (green) in your passport, your departure was not properly recorded. For the most current procedures on turning in your I-94 in order to correct your travel record, please visit the U.S. Customs and Border Protection site.

Can you submit false information on a visa application?

Remember: You alone are responsible for the accuracy of the information in your application. Intentionally submitting false information either on the application itself or during the visa interview can lead to a finding of a permanent ineligibility. Never sign the application you are submitting without reviewing it first for accuracy if you have had help filling it out.
